Left side is bank 1 cylinder 1-3 right side is bank 2 cylinder 4-6

You want the values to be close together,

Fuel adaptation is the ECU’s “learned correction” for the fuel mixture.

Your DME is constantly trying to keep the air/fuel mixture correct. It looks at the oxygen sensors, then adjusts injector pulse width to add or remove fuel.

I imported a euro m3 from the UK to Australia in 2022. I wish I would have had an inspection done by a 3rd party. The one I got looked exceptional clean on top and didnt get one done. Take a good look underneath that car mate. They salt the roads in UK and that leads to rust all underneath. 11k seems really good price. But I assume a lot of work needs doing.
